База знаний
Войдите в личный кабинет для возможности задавать вопросы и отвечать на комментарии.
FAQ

Как заменить наименование товара в категории на seo-название?

Поддержка Bodysite
Поддержка Bodysite
1 февраля 2023 15:47
+1

Вы можете заменить обычное наименование товара при отображении в категории на SEO-название.

Для этого в шаблон категории (каталога) нужно добавить конструкцию: 

{$product = shopSeoViewHelper::extendProduct($product)}

Обратите внимание на переменную $product - это данные товара. Возможно, в вашей теме дизайна разработчик использует другое название переменной, например: $p или $item.product

Манипуляции с шаблонами могут производиться в разделе Витрина - Шаблоны. 

Пример встраивания конструкции в теме Megashop 2.0:

Вариант отображения товаров "Плитка": файл шаблона products-thumb.html

Добавляем конструкцию после 3 строки:

Вариант отображения товаров "Список": файл шаблона products-extends.html

После 75 строки добавляем конструкцию следующим образом:

Вариант отображения товаров "Таблица": файл шаблона products-compact.html

После 67 строки добавляем конструкцию:

Пример встраивания конструкции в теме Гипермаркет:

Файл шаблона products.items.html

После 17 строки в любом месте вставляете конструкцию:

Как найти место, куда добавить конструкцию в вашей теме дизайна?

Вариант А: спросить у разработчика темы дизайна.

Вариант Б: Кликаете правой кнопкой мышки на названии товара - пункт "Посмотреть код". Далее откроется консоль разработчика, в которой вы сможете увидеть, как называется стиль у названия товара, либо какого-то другого элемента рядом пример:

Далее перебираете файлы темы дизайна и через CTRL+F ищете это название в шаблонах.

0 комментариев
Добавить комментарий
Чтобы добавить комментарий, войдите в личный кабинет